Melatonin, an endogenous-specific inhibitor of estrogen receptor alpha via calmodulin.
The Journal of biological chemistry - 10 Sept 2004
del Río Beatriz, García Pedrero Juana M, Martínez-Campa Carlos, Zuazua Pedro, Lazo Pedro S, Ramos Sofía
Abstract excerpt
Melatonin is an indole hormone produced mainly by the pineal gland. We have previously demonstrated that melatonin interferes with estrogen (E(2)) signaling in MCF7 cells by impairing estrogen receptor (ER) pathways. Here we present the characterization of its mechanism of action showing that melatonin is a specific inhibitor of E(2)-induced ERalpha-mediated transcription in both estrogen response element- and...
